Chess Puzzle #qYEx0 — Advanced, Black to move, opening

Rating 1868 · Advanced · equality, middlegame, short.

Position

White: king e1; queen c2; rooks a1/h1; bishops c1/d3; knights c3/f3; pawns a3/b3/d4/e5/f4/g3/h2. Black: king e8; queen d8; rooks a8/h8; bishops e6/e7; knights e3/f5; pawns a7/b7/c6/d5/f7/g6/h6. Material is balanced. Black to move.

Solution (2 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Bxe3 — bishop c1→e3, captures knight. Now Black to move.
  2. Best move: Nxe3 — knight f5→e3, captures bishop. Opponent replies Qc1 (queen c2→c1).
  3. Best move: Nf5 — knight e3→f5.

Tactical themes

equality, middlegame, short. The key move Nxe3 wins material.
